Transaction 74c640eb53e83a5a3047ad1190aecf270d65d7d975848664ae93f0110322d581
1 Input
1 Output
-
74c640eb53e83a5a3047ad1190aecf270d65d7d975848664ae93f0110322d581:0
- value
- 793403
- script pubkey
- OP_0 OP_PUSHBYTES_20 4eec9b85c5d33a99e4557afd5b28212d1210d7e5
- address
- bc1qfmkfhpw96vafnez40t74k2pp95fpp4l9q97cgx